ce188d4d 1/*********************************************************************
2* Filename: md5_test.c
3* Author: Brad Conte (brad AT bradconte.com)
4* Copyright:
5* Disclaimer: This code is presented "as is" without any guarantees.
6* Details: Performs known-answer tests on the corresponding MD5
7 implementation. These tests do not encompass the full
8 range of available test vectors, however, if the tests
9 pass it is very, very likely that the code is correct
10 and was compiled properly. This code also serves as
11 example usage of the functions.
12*********************************************************************/
13
14/*************************** HEADER FILES ***************************/
15#include <stdio.h>
16#include <memory.h>
17#include <string.h>
18#include "md5.h"
19
20/*********************** FUNCTION DEFINITIONS ***********************/
21int md5_test()
22{
23 BYTE text1[] = {""};
24 BYTE text2[] = {"abc"};
25 BYTE text3_1[] = {"ABCDEFGHIJKLMNOPQRSTUVWXYZabcde"};
26 BYTE text3_2[] = {"fghijklmnopqrstuvwxyz0123456789"};
27 BYTE hash1[MD5_BLOCK_SIZE] = {0xd4,0x1d,0x8c,0xd9,0x8f,0x00,0xb2,0x04,0xe9,0x80,0x09,0x98,0xec,0xf8,0x42,0x7e};
28 BYTE hash2[MD5_BLOCK_SIZE] = {0x90,0x01,0x50,0x98,0x3c,0xd2,0x4f,0xb0,0xd6,0x96,0x3f,0x7d,0x28,0xe1,0x7f,0x72};
29 BYTE hash3[MD5_BLOCK_SIZE] = {0xd1,0x74,0xab,0x98,0xd2,0x77,0xd9,0xf5,0xa5,0x61,0x1c,0x2c,0x9f,0x41,0x9d,0x9f};
30 BYTE buf[16];
31 MD5_CTX ctx;
32 int pass = 1;
33
34 md5_init(&ctx);
35 md5_update(&ctx, text1, strlen(text1));
36 md5_final(&ctx, buf);
37 pass = pass && !memcmp(hash1, buf, MD5_BLOCK_SIZE);
38
39 // Note the MD5 object can be reused.
40 md5_init(&ctx);
41 md5_update(&ctx, text2, strlen(text2));
42 md5_final(&ctx, buf);
43 pass = pass && !memcmp(hash2, buf, MD5_BLOCK_SIZE);
44
45 // Note the data is being added in two chunks.
46 md5_init(&ctx);
47 md5_update(&ctx, text3_1, strlen(text3_1));
48 md5_update(&ctx, text3_2, strlen(text3_2));
49 md5_final(&ctx, buf);
50 pass = pass && !memcmp(hash3, buf, MD5_BLOCK_SIZE);
51
52 return(pass);
53}
54
55int main()
56{
57 printf("MD5 tests: %s\n", md5_test() ? "SUCCEEDED" : "FAILED");
58
59 return(0);
60}
